What is Webflow?
Webflow is a powerful and intuitive platform that allows users to create stunning, custom websites with no need for extensive coding knowledge. It combines a visual website builder with a robust content management system (CMS), a revolutionary approach to web development. Whether you are a designer, marketer, or developer, Webflow offers tools that cater to your unique workflow.
One of Webflow's standout features is its user-friendly visual interface, enabling designers and marketers to create sites using a drag-and-drop method. Users can interact with HTML, CSS, and JavaScript directly within a visual canvas, making it accessible to those unfamiliar with these languages. This flexibility ensures that teams can manage their web presence quickly and efficiently without extensive technical support.

Scalability and Security
For enterprises looking to scale their web presence, Webflow offers robust hosting and security features. The platform integrates seamlessly with existing tech stacks, enabling businesses to grow without compromising on security or performance. With fast, reliable hosting that is powered by Amazon's CloudFront CDN, Webflow can manage millions of simultaneous visits, ensuring that your site remains operational even during traffic surges.
Webflow’s enterprise solutions come equipped with advanced security features such as Single Sign-On (SSO), customizable security headers, and guaranteed uptime, making it a secure choice for any business.

Yes, Webflow features native integrations with various tools and services, allowing you to connect your site with marketing, analytics, and e-commerce platforms. For instance, you can integrate with HubSpot for CRM purposes, use Stripe for payment processing, or connect to analytics tools to monitor site performance. Additionally, Webflow offers extensive APIs for more advanced integrations.
Webflow includes robust SEO tools that allow you to manage meta titles, descriptions, and schema markup directly within the platform. It offers easy sitemap management and 301 redirects without needing technical support. Furthermore, the high-performance hosting ensures fast load times, which are essential for SEO. Users can also make data-driven improvements using built-in analytics to enhance discoverability and search performance.
